第一步:先更新英伟达驱动到最新版
第二步:安装cuda10.0驱动,这里注意为避免TensorFlow兼容性问题 cuda安装10版本就足够学习和使用了,
注意安装位置就选择默认的位置,如果更换位置,可能给以后的操作带来不便
安装cuda时,选择自定义安装 安装内容全部打钩安装,其他全部默认设置就行
第三步:安装cudnn10.0,这里为了配套,安装10.0就行
cudnn10.0其实就是压缩文件,解压后得到三个文件夹,把这个三个文件夹放入cuda对应的文件夹中就行
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.1\bin
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.1\include
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.1\lib\x64
再将上面三个路径添加到环境变量中的path中。
一般是上面三个位置,环境变量添加完是这个样子
第四步:安装anaconda3,这个没有版本限制,推荐最新版
第五步:在anconda3中创建新的工作环境,python版本选择3.7
第六步:下载TensorFlow-gpu,国内环境下 注意使用国内镜像源:
pip install tensorflow-gpu -i https://pypi.tuna.tsinghua.edu.cn/simple
第七步:测试TensorFlow-gpu是否安装成功
import tensorflow as tf
hello = tf.constant('Hello, TensorFlow!')
sess = tf.Session()
print(sess.run(hello))
如果没有异常报错就算安装成功了,安装成功的话 会显示
本笔记中用到的软件下面地址中可以下载到
链接: https://pan.baidu.com/s/1rLpjzpO5je-6CQ6-1Ksr1A 提取码: vnm2 复制这段内容后打开百度网盘手机App,操作更方便哦